TL;DR Summary

US Senator Elizabeth Warren has blamed the failure of Signature Bank on its acceptance of crypto customers without sufficient safeguards. Warren has demanded answers from the CEO of Signature Bank regarding the "economically disastrous outcomes" created by the bank's "bad decision-making and excessive risk-taking." The senator alleged that Signature Bank took on "excessive risk" to boost its bottom line by serving crypto clients, such as Coinbase, Paxos, and FTX, and that the bank was wholly unequipped to manage risk independently. The US Department of Justice and the Securities and Exchange Commission were already investigating Signature Bank's work with cryptocurrency clients before regulators took possession of the bank last Sunday.
